#5e0658 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e0658 is composed of 36.9% red, 2.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 6.4%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 304.1 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 19.6%. #5e0658 color hex could be obtained by blending #bc0cb0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#5e0658
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#feeef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e0658
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343033 is the less saturated color, while #62025b is the most saturated one.
